Mental Health
It’s not surprising that studies are starting to show strength training as an effective treatment to reduce mental health symptoms such as depression, anxiety and PTSD.
Getting to the gym 3 or 4 days a week is a great way to hold yourself accountable and build a life-changing habit. Building this discipline will carry over into all aspects of life and will have a positive effect on your mood.

Every time you show up to the gym plus increasing weights or reps you get a small win. Stacking small wins starts to add up and eventually leads to significant changes in all aspects of life.
In simple terms, strength training will help you feel really good!
Increase Self-Belief
Strength training gives you belief in yourself because you are constantly watching yourself improve. Making progress and reaching your goals do wonders for your confidence.
A great way to see progress is to track your weights and repetitions for each workout. At D8 Training we have an app where clients can add their weights and reps so that they can see improvement over time.
It is a tremendous feeling than getting a personal best in the gym. It shows you’ve gotten significantly better and that sense of pride in yourself is priceless. Which carries over to other areas of life.
